The heterogeneous reduction of arsenic (V) with sulphur dioxide (SO2) gas has been systematically investigated to understand the kinetics involved in the process. The primary objective of this study is to identify the rate-limiting homogeneous reactions between undissociated arsenic (V) species and undissociated sulphurous acid and bisulphite ions. A series of experiments were conducted to analyze the reaction rates at varying concentrations and flow rates of SO2, maintaining a consistent concentration in solution. The results indicate that the overall reaction rate is directly proportional to the partial pressure of SO2, while showing independence from the partial pressure of oxygen in the gas phase. The investigation also shows that the solubility of SO2 significantly impacts reaction kinetics, with the reaction rate appearing constant within a temperature range of 313-343 K. A general rate equation characterizing the dependency of arsenic (V) reduction on the reactants is provided, wherein the rate constants are functions of temperature. This comprehensive study adds valuable knowledge to the field of hydrometallurgy, specifically regarding the kinetics of arsenic reduction using SO2, highlighting the efficiency and conditions for maximizing arsenic trioxide production.
